uncommunicated

[ˌənkəˈmjuːnɪkeɪtɪd]

uncommunicated Definition

not communicated or expressed to others.

Summary: uncommunicated in Brief

'Uncommunicated' [ˌənkəˈmjuːnɪkeɪtɪd] is an adjective that describes something that has not been communicated or expressed to others. It is often used to describe hidden feelings or undisclosed information, as in 'His true feelings remained uncommunicated.' The term can also be used to describe a lack of communication within a group, as in 'The message was left uncommunicated to the rest of the team.'
